Anduril Industries is a defense technology company with a mission to transform U.S. and allied military capabilities with advanced technology. By bringing the expertise, technology, and business model of the 21st century's most innovative companies to the defense industry, Anduril is changing how military systems are designed, built and sold. Anduril's family of systems is powered by Lattice OS, an AI-powered operating system that turns thousands of data streams into a realtime, 3D command and control center.
As the world enters an era of strategic competition, Anduril is committed to bringing cutting-edge autonomy, AI, computer vision, sensor fusion, and networking technology to the military in months, not years.

ABOUT
THE ROLE
We are seeking an experienced and detail-oriented Lead Production Technician to oversee and coordinate the technical fabrication, assembly, integration, and testing of complex electro-mechanical and avionics systems. The ideal candidate will provide technical guidance, ensure quality standards, and collaborate closely with engineering and production teams in a fast-paced environment.
WHAT YOU'LL DO
* Lead and mentor a team of technicians in aircraft, automotive, or similar fabrication and assembly processes, including structural fabrication, mechanical integration, composites fabrication, and avionics build/integration/test.
* Supervise and participate in airframe construction techniques such as riveting, use of mechanical fasteners, nut plates, and ensure adherence to quality standards.
* Oversee mechanical assembly of complex electro-mechanical assemblies, high-quality wire harnesses, test racks, junction boxes, and component fabrication including hand soldering.
* Coordinate and perform validation and testing of electronic components using equipment such as multimeters, oscilloscopes, network analyzers, and test racks.
* Review and verify wiring diagrams and assembly instructions to ensure accurate build and integration.
* Manage workflow in a dynamic environment, rapidly adjusting roles and responsibilities to meet production priorities and deadlines.
* Facilitate effective verbal and written communication between technicians, engineering, and production teams to resolve technical challenges and improve processes.
* Assist in troubleshooting and diagnosing issues discovered during functional checkouts and tests.
* Ensure compliance with safety protocols and regulatory requirements.
* Working in digital tools to interpret KPI's and execution
* Delegation/flow down of daily work orders to techs
* Lead daily stand ups.
* Conduct and complete FOD audits at the start and end of each shift.
RE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S
* Demonstrated broad experience with aircraft, automotive, or similar fabrication, assembly, and operation including both structural and electronic systems.
* Proficient with hand tools, light power tools, and standard computer applications (web browsers, word processing).
* Working knowledge of electrical components and ability to read wiring diagrams.
* Strong organizational skills with the ability to lead a team and man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
* Excellent communication skills to work effectively with cross-functional teams.
* Experience with validation, testing, and mechanical assembly of complex electro-mechanical systems.
* U.S. Citizenship is required.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S
* Prior hands-on experience building kits, models, or similar product lines.
* Experience programming integrated digital systems by loading firmware.
* Airframe and Powerplant (A&P) license or equivalent training.
* Forklift certification.
* Experience in piece-part fabrication such as sheet metal work (waterjet, press brake) and subtractive manufacturing (machining).
